Event and Visitor Passport FAQs

What is G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port?

G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port is used to help facilitate access to meetings, events, or venues having ten or more people. 

How does G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port work?

Event attendees will complete the GuideSafe Healthcheck, a COVID-19 assessment tool, prior to the gathering.  Event and Visitor Passport issues clearance to an event based on a proprietary COVID-19 risk algorithm. Each user is assigned a unique passport number indicating their status for the upcoming event. 

Why is my organization using G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port?

The COVID-19 pandemic is an extraordinary situation requiring significant measures to create a safe work and educational communities. Organizations use G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port to manage large scale engagements like events, conferences, or large group meetings to keep their workplace or campus healthy and limit the spread of the virus.

If I receive a “Not Clear” status in the Event and Visitor Passport, will I really not be allowed to enter?

If you received a status of “Not Clear” from the G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port for a specific event, meeting or facility, you will not be permitted to enter. Event and Visitor Passport helps manage large groups and prevent further exposure to COVID-19. 

Is G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port secure? Is my privacy protected?

G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port is a HIPAA compliant platform. The application does not track you as a person or your location. Each user is assigned a unique passport number indicating their status for the upcoming event. 

Will I remain anonymous?

Your organization will receive your information submitted through the G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port. The information is to ensure compliance and to identify employees or students who may need to be tested to further prevent the spread of COVID-19. 

When do I complete G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port?

G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port is available after you have completed GuideSafe Healthcheck. After you have completed Healthcheck, press the “Passport” button to get your passport. This passport is good for 24 hours. Remember your passport number to access your passport later in the day. After the 24-hour passport has expired, you will need to complete Healthcheck again. 

How do I access G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port?

You can access GuideSafe Event and Visitor Passport on a phone, tablet, or computer. It is mobile-enabled so that it can be easily viewed on your phone. The site can be pinned to your smartphone home screen so that it appears as an app.
